"What is this madness!?"  I hear you cry.

Amy (the 5'2 midget legs hamster) has decided to run the whole bloomin' London Marathon. Is she MAD!? Someone has told her it is OVER TWENTY SIX MILES long?....and she is still determined to do it!? Blimey! 

True enough 26 miles and 385 yards is no walk in the park but it is what I like to call "a challenge" and I am running for an excellent cause.

I am honoured to be running for such an amazing charity as ACTION FOR CHILDREN, an organisation that does so much for young people.

Action for Children is committed to helping the most vulnerable children and young people in the UK break through injustice, deprivation and inequality, so they can achieve their full potential.
